Association of Lower Saxony Educational Initiatives
The Association of Lower Saxony Educational Initiatives (VNB) is a Hanover- based association of 47 member organizations that carry out self-organized educational work with different focus areas .
history
The association was founded on June 12, 1983. It sees itself as an educational institution for non-governmental organizations in Lower Saxony. In 1990 the Lower Saxony Ministry for Science and Culture recognized it as a state institution for adult education under the Lower Saxony Adult Education Act.
meaning
In the VNB-Bildungswerk, people and institutions from the ecological movement , the peace movement and the one-world movement work together. Further focal points are the areas of global and intercultural learning as well as gender-related educational work ( gender area ). The main goals of the VNB educational work include the promotion of individual self-realization , political participation and social engagement on an equal footing .
Three regional offices and the state office in Hanover coordinate cooperation with over 200 educational initiatives and conference centers throughout Lower Saxony. In this educational network around 3800 people are mainly volunteers. The members of the VNB include the Heimvolkshochschule Akademie Waldschlösschen and the Association for Development Policy Lower Saxony .
The VNB operates nationwide as a sending organization for weltwärts , the international voluntary service of the Federal Ministry for Economic Cooperation and Development. Together with Bündnis 90 / Die Grünen , he is the donor of the Heinrich Böll Foundation in Lower Saxony - Life and Environment Foundation. He works with other regional associations of independent alternative further education, z. B. the state working group for another further education in North Rhine-Westphalia , the state working group for other learning in Rhineland-Palatinate and the state working group for political-cultural education in Brandenburg within the framework of the federal working group for other further education eV
In 2018, 13,152 participants took advantage of the training courses offered by the VNB as part of the Lower Saxony Adult Education Act. Then there are the visitors to the conferences and the mobile learning exhibitions . The VNB exhibition project Anne Frank - a story for today was awarded the Innovation Prize 2013 of the Lower Saxony Confederation for independent adult education .
